The Importance of Emotional Support Animals

Emotional support animals play a crucial role in the lives of those who struggle with mental health issues such as anxiety, depression, and post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). Unlike regular pets, ESAs are prescribed as part of a mental health treatment plan. They are not required to undergo specialized training like service animals, but their presence alone can significantly improve the emotional well-being of their owner.

Many people find that having an ESA helps them manage daily stressors and provides a unique form of therapy that medication or traditional therapy might not achieve. The bond between an individual and their ESA can be incredibly strong, offering a non-judgmental, loving presence that helps mitigate feelings of loneliness and isolation.

How to Obtain an ESA Letter

Obtaining an ESA letter involves a straightforward process but requires careful attention to ensure all legal requirements are met. One must first consult with a licensed mental health professional, who will evaluate whether an ESA is a suitable part of the individual’s treatment plan. This professional can be a psychologist, psychiatrist, or therapist who is qualified to assess the mental health condition.

Once the need for an ESA is established, the professional will issue a letter that officially designates the animal as an emotional support animal. This letter should include the professional’s license number, the date of issuance, and a statement confirming the individual’s need for the ESA. Legal Rights and Responsibilities

With an ESA letter, individuals gain certain legal protections under the Fair Housing Act (FHA) and the Air Carrier Access Act (ACAA). These laws allow ESAs to live with their owners in housing that typically prohibits pets and to fly with them in the cabin of an aircraft. However, it’s important for ESA owners to understand their responsibilities. They must ensure their animal is well-behaved and does not pose a threat or cause damage.

Landlords and airlines can request to see the ESA letter, but they are not allowed to ask about the owner’s specific mental health condition. This respect for privacy is crucial in maintaining the dignity and rights of individuals who rely on emotional support animals. Those who misuse ESA letters or falsely claim their pet as an ESA can face penalties, highlighting the importance of honesty and integrity in the process.
